Ok Taecyeon was enjoying a good F1 race on his big television, taking his time to rest his tired body after the continuous oversea meeting he had to attend in the past week. He feels like going to his favorite club to see his favorite girl but at some point he’s just too tired to get his up simply to drag himself into the basement of his apartment to get his car.

A call from an unknown number interrupts his gaze from the screen, just by one peek into the unknown number, he decided to ignore the call and rises his TV volume instead. The caller is persistent enough to try calling him for the next three times and finally he decided to pick it up.

“Who is it?” He asks sharply without trying to be nice at all, hating to be interrupted.

“Good evening, Is this Ok Taecyeon? The owner of an electric blue Mini Cooper with 12-ha-9757 number?” The voice sounds formal.

He changes his seating position and presses the phone closer to his ear, the caller definitely grabs his attention at once. “Yes, that’s correct, is something wrong?”

“I’m from the insurance company, reporting from the police station about your car.”

“The car is under my name, but currently used by my friend.” He responds, “Is everything okay? Is she in trouble because of the ownership? I lend it to her so it’s okay, she’s not stealing it or anything.” He explains for some more, worrying that his friend is stuck with the authorities because of this small detail.

“Do you happen to know the person that’s driving your car tonight?”

“Ne, Kang Seulri. What happen to her? Is she breaking any rule?” His seating position has gone from lounging to straight up.

“I’m afraid she involved in an accident, sir. Her car crashed and flipped over near Incheon and she’s now being taking care of in Incheon’s student hospital.”

“WHAT? HOW?”

“If you don’t mind, you can come to the Incheon police station to take care of the insurance paper..”

“Insurance paper my ! I don’t care about that! what happened to her? is she okay?” He gets up from his seat and prepares himself to get out of his apartment.

“A truck driver ran into her, the crash flipped the car upside down and broke the front window and there’re some other things that are broken that we need to..”

“Ajjushi, are you even human?” Taecyon snaps at him. “My friend is having an accident and here you are talking about the toll it caused to my car!”

“It’s the basic protocol..”

“Tell me where she is right now, do whatever you want with the car and just send the bill into the account your company hold on to.” He takes his car key and takes big steps towards the elevator.

“I’m sorry,” The caller says, “She’s now in Incheon student hospital, probably in the emergency room. That’s all I know. The police said..”

Taecyeon doesn’t let the caller finish his words, he quickly gets into his other car to start it up then goes full throttle towards Incheon.

His mind keeps on wondering wild on his way to the hospital, Kang Seulri, oh he doesn’t know where to begin to describe her.

Their first meeting might be wrong in any aspect, their friendship was the weird one and certainly he can say his relationship with her is much more intimate than just being friendly. But Seulri was the girl that could make his heart beats faster whenever he sees the smile on her face, he could feel the pain she keeps inside her whenever she stares at him with her dead looking eyes and she’s the only one that made him went down on his knees three times just to save her from her messy life.

And Seulri was also the only one that kept on telling him ‘no’.

The night he met her the first time was just another night he spent strolling around while being the jerk he always was. He’s always seen as the person who played around all the time and tried to have fun in any occasion. Most of his business meeting were done on the golf course or gym instead of in the office, his working space were filled with any kind of childish game arcades and nobody ever dared to asked him when he’d get his self together and grow up. Because he’s a great business man, he’s a great negotiator and also an excellent speaker that had made his grandfather’s company grew even bigger than it already was.

His parents probably were on the edge of their desperation when they realize that their son would never grow up, but they’re also the kind that raised him with much freedom for Taecyeon. His mother always said that he could play as hard as he worked, as long as he’s doing great in his life then he could goof around to balance his hard work, a life value he carried on until this day.

In a humid summer night about seven years ago, Ok Taecyeon just got the biggest business deal his company needed to expand their wings to the neighboring country. It’s something his father has fought for quite a while yet in the end, Taecyeon’s negotiating skill was the one that the goal for them. He figured it was time to give himself a little present and celebration so he took some of his friends to go to a club where they usually hang out to.

A gentlemen’s club was not a place crowded with well-tailored gentlemen with manners and dignity, it was in fact a club where those jerks that dared to called themselves gentlemen gathered to find some false-joy by being treated nicely by these pathetic women who were dead inside and measured their self-worth by the amount of the equally desperate guys wanting them and how much money they could squeeze out of them. But he didn’t care, he knew that he was indeed living a pathetic life and he just wanted to find solace from the desperation he held on into his heart for too long.

That night, he came inside with his friends and looked around to see the collection of girls the club could offer them. He’s all bored with his usual option already, the club sure needed to upgrade their game and recruited more new girls because the ones available was all old and boring for him to play with. With his arrogant manner, Taecyeon called the owner of the club—a friend of his—to deliver his great costumer review.

“So, do you want your usual girl?” Lee Hyukjae greeted him and gave him a firm handshake. “Give him a gin and tonic so he could loosen up a bit.” He ordered the bartender behind him.

“Honestly, you need to upgrade man.” Taecyeon turned his head to the strip pole available in the middle of the club, “These girls you have here were getting rusty.”

“Ey! Don’t say that, my club is still the best one around.” He took the glass of gin and tonic his bartender prepared him and offered the tall glass to Taecyeon. “Tell you what, I did recruit some new girls but they’re still under training. You know those desperate girls that never even shake their before, so stiff and awkward. Just wait a little while, I’ll introduce you to the most pretty one once she’s ready.”
